Teambuilding Process

Why use broken Greninja when you can go with the one true wallbreaker, Crawdaunt?




Dragon-Fairy-Steel core, covers revenge killing, hazard control and pivoting.






Tangrowth so I don't lose to Zygarde. Celesteela so I don't lose to Kingra/Greninja. Also helps wear down the opposition.
The Team

Crawdaunt @ Choice Band
Ability: Adaptability
EVs: 252 Atk / 4 Def / 252 Spe
Jolly Nature
- Aqua Jet
- Knock Off
- Crabhammer
- Crunch

Tapu Lele @ Choice Scarf
Ability: Psychic Surge
EVs: 252 SpA / 4 SpD / 252 Spe
Timid Nature
IVs: 0 Atk
- Psychic
- Moonblast
- Focus Blast
- Thunderbolt

Garchomp @ Rocky Helmet
Ability: Rough Skin
EVs: 248 HP / 160 Def / 88 SpD / 12 Spe
Impish Nature
- Stealth Rock
- Earthquake
- Dragon Tail
- Toxic

Scizor-Mega @ Scizorite
Ability: Technician
EVs: 248 HP / 188 Def / 56 SpD / 16 Spe
Impish Nature
- Bullet Punch
- U-turn
- Roost
- Defog

Tangrowth @ Assault Vest
Ability: Regenerator
EVs: 248 HP / 8 Def / 252 SpD
Sassy Nature
- Giga Drain
- Knock Off
- Hidden Power [Ice]
- Earthquake

Celesteela @ Leftovers
Ability: Beast Boost
EVs: 252 HP / 4 Def / 252 SpD
Careful Nature
- Leech Seed
- Protect
- Heavy Slam
- Flamethrower

Heatran beats the defensive core of Tangrowth + Celesteela as well as checking Lele and Scizor. Crawdaunt and Garchomp need to be played aggresively to eliminate it or keep it out at all times.

Magnezone traps Celesteela and Scizor if they're not doubled out. Wearing it down with rocks and Leech Seed for Chomp is the way to go depending on the opponent's team comp. Crawdaunt can also beat it after some chip since Timid Zone is not a common thing anymore.


Both Zards are incredibly difficult to deal with if Stealth Rock is not up. Zard-Y can be beaten with the combination of Tapu Lele + Chomp + Crawdaunt. Zard-X needs to be chipped by Chomp or recoil so Crawdaunt can revenge kill.

Mega Heracross easily breaks this team if either Lele or Celesteela goes down. It can be chipped by Chomp and Celesteela can scare it out with full HP.


Electric-types with Fire+Ice coverage are very difficult to switch into and take out. Wearing them down with Leech Seed and Stealth Rock is the best way to deal with them, requiring predictions along the way to conserve HP on Celesteela.
Conclusion
While this team is nowhere near serious, it's still successful if played correctly. Wearing the opponent down, forcing switches is the way to go with this team. It forces you to predict and double switch a lot, so I feel like it's a good team to use if you're learning to play on another level. Also Crawdaunt has 6-0ed stall so this team has won my heart. C:
